Hi,
This a protocol I'm trying to implement but I can't figure out what's
the
CRC algorithm used (assuming that it's indeed a CRC).
Here are some captures, I included those that I consider more helpful.
This packages are all 136 bytes long, all the .... are filled with
0x00,
each line is a diferent packet except the last one.
26 00 00 00 .... 00 AD D2 7E
26 05 00 00 .... 00 2A 24 7E
26 04 00 00 .... 00 0B BA 7E
26 20 00 00 .... 00 AE 8F 7E
26 21 00 00 .... 00 8F 11 7E
26 22 00 00 .... 00 FD BB 7E
26 23 00 00 .... 00 DC 25 7E
26 24 00 00 .... 00 08 E7 7E
26 28 00 00 .... 00 E2 5E 7E
26 02 01 00 .... 00 C4 1E 7E
27 43 02 15 38 30 39 33 30 37 36 35 35 30 40 61 6C 6C 74 65 6C 2E 6E
65\
74 00 .... 00 16 07 7E
There are other packages of different lengths also.
41 30 30 30 30 30 30 DF 8A 7E
41 01 70 41 7E
29 01 00 31 40 7E
I tried to apply the method described here:
http://www.derkeiler.com/Newsgroups/sci.crypt/2006-05/msg01205.html
with the 26 2x packets, but I got an strange result:
26 00 = ADD2
26 20 = AE8F
26 21 = 8F11
26 22 = FDBB
26 24 = 08E7
26 28 = E25E
AE8F^8F11=219E
AE8F^FDBB=5334
AE8F^08E7=A668
AE8F^E25E=4CD1
219E*2 ^ 5334 = 1008
5334*2 ^ A668 = 0
A668*2 ^ 4CD1 = 10001
It feels like I'm almost there but I must be missing something
obvious.
Any ideas?
